Cleaning Your Machine
This section describes the cleaning procedure that is needed to maintain your machine.
Cleaning the Platen Glass and Document Cover
Moisten a clean, soft, lint-free cloth and wring out excess water. With it, wipe the Platen Glass
(A) and the inner side of the Document Cover (white sheet) (B). Then wipe with another clean,
soft, dry, lint-free cloth, making sure not to leave any residue, especially on the Platen Glass.
Caution
z Be sure to turn off the power and disconnect the power cord before cleaning the machine.
z Do not use tissue paper, paper towels, or similar materials for cleaning. Paper tissue powders or fine
threads may remain inside the machine and cause problems such as a blocked Print Head and poor
printing results. Use a soft cloth to avoid scratching the components.
z Never use volatile liquids such as thinners, benzene, acetone, or any other chemical cleaner to clean
the machine; these can damage the machine’s components.
Important
The sheet (B) is easily damaged, so wipe it gently.
